- 1、有哪些信誉好的足球投注网站(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
- 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
- 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
- 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们。
- 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
- 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
物联网实验与实训操作考核试卷及答案
考试时间:______分钟总分:______分姓名:______
一、选择题(每题2分,共20分)
1.下列哪一项不属于物联网系统的典型架构层?
A.感知层
B.网络层
C.应用层
D.数据存储层
2.在物联网设备通信中,MQTT协议通常被归类为:
A.HTTP/HTTPS协议
B.低功耗广域网协议(LPWAN)
C.消息队列遥测传输协议
D.有线以太网协议
3.以下哪种传感器通常用于检测环境中的光照强度?
A.温湿度传感器
B.压力传感器
C.光敏传感器
D.红外传感器
4.将传感器采集到的模拟信号转换为数字信号的过程称为:
A.滤波
B.放大
C.模数转换(ADC)
D.数模转换(DAC)
5.在使用Arduino等开发板进行物联网项目开发时,通常使用的编程语言是:
A.Java
B.Python
C.C/C++
D.PHP
6.以下哪种技术常用于实现低功耗广域物联网网络?
A.Wi-Fi
B.Zigbee
C.LoRaWAN
D.BluetoothLowEnergy(BLE)
7.物联网云平台通常提供哪种服务,用于将设备采集的数据存储和管理?
A.设备接入管理
B.数据存储与分析
C.规则引擎
D.应用开发接口
8.在物联网应用开发中,用于实现设备与云平台之间数据传输的接口通常称为:
A.API
B.SDK
C.协议
D.接口板
9.以下哪项不是物联网安全面临的主要挑战?
A.设备物理安全
B.数据传输安全
C.操作系统安全
D.用户界面设计美观
10.使用串口通信时,串口号和波特率是必须配置的参数,它们分别表示:
A.通信协议和数据传输速率
B.通信端口和数据传输速率
C.通信协议和设备地址
D.通信端口和设备地址
二、填空题(每空1分,共15分)
1.物联网的英文名称是________。
2.常用的物联网感知层设备包括传感器和________。
3.将设备接入互联网常用的两种方式是________和有线网络连接。
4.在嵌入式系统中,编写和下载程序到微控制器的过程通常称为________。
5.MQTT协议中,消息的三种主要QoS等级是0(________)、1(________)和2(________)。
6.云平台中,用于根据设备数据自动触发动作或服务的功能称为________。
7.在进行硬件调试时,万用表是一种常用的________工具。
8.C语言中,用于输出字符串的函数是________。
9.如果传感器输出的是模拟电压信号,而微控制器只认识数字信号,那么需要使用________进行转换。
10.物联网应用层是物联网系统与________交互的层面。
三、简答题(每题5分,共20分)
1.简述物联网系统感知层的主要功能。
2.简述使用Arduino连接一个光敏传感器,并编写代码读取其模拟值的基本步骤。
3.简述在物联网云平台上注册一个设备的基本流程。
4.简述在物联网项目开发中,进行软硬件调试时可能遇到的问题及相应的解决思路。
四、设计题(每题10分,共20分)
1.设计一个简单的物联网门禁系统。该系统应能通过手机APP远程查看门的状态(开/关),并能远程控制门的开关。请简述系统所需硬件组件(至少列出三种)、软件平台(云平台或本地服务器)、数据传输方式以及主要的功能实现逻辑。
2.假设你需要设计一个用于监测室内温湿度的物联网节点。请简述该节点需要哪些关键硬件组件?在软件层面,你需要编写哪些程序功能来实现:温湿度数据的采集、数据的格式化、通过MQTT协议将数据发送到云平台,并说明选择MQTT协议的理由。
五、编程实践题(共25分)
假设你正在使用Arduino开发板和一个DHT11温湿度传感器进行项目开发。请根据以下要求,描述或伪编写相应的Arduino代码片段。
1.(10分)编写代码初始化串口通信,设置波特率为9600,并编写代码读取DHT11传感器返回的温湿度数据,通过串口将温度和湿度值打印出来。注意说明如何处理DHT11的数据读取和校验。
2.(15分)在读取到温湿度数据后,请编写代码判断当前温度
有哪些信誉好的足球投注网站
文档评论(0)